With an onsite helipad, Stillpoint Lodge provides helicopter adventures right from the doorstep. Offering a spectacular bird’s eye view of the wondrous Alaskan landscapes, these trips will be a highlight of any vacation. While there are three set itineraries, guests have the scope for customized trips to suit their interests, although these can be subject to weather conditions, location of wildlife and aircraft availability.
The itineraries on offer include a 2-hour wildlife and glacier heli-tour on which you will get aerial views of the ice field, mountains, waterfalls, and wildlife. The trip includes a landing and the chance to walk on a glacier. There is also a 6-hour heli-hiking tour, where hikers are dropped off for an easy and spectacular hike above the treeline. Hikers can either hike down for a boat pickup or request to be picked up back at the top by the helicopter for the journey back to the lodge. For those looking for the ultimate heli-safari, the lodge offers an 8-hour excursion that takes in glaciers, volcanoes, and bear viewing.
